Donald Calvert Helps David R. Byrd Exit Possible Slave Tunnel Discovered Under Washtenaw Lumber Building, November 1972 Photographer: Jack Stubbs
Year:
1972
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, November 3, 1973
Caption:
A former underground railway tunnel for escaped slaves? That's what David Byrd of the Black Economic Development League (BEDL) says has been uncovered at the BEDL building site on Depot Street at the Broadway Bridge. The discovery was made while footings were being dug for the building which will be used for offices and spaces for classes in such subjects as photography, printing and drafting. Donald Calvert (left) of Calvert Brothers Construction Co. gives Byrd a helping hand after and inspection of the tunnel.
